命名空间
变体
操作

std::basic_ios<CharT,Traits>::widen

来自 cppreference.com
< cpp‎ | io‎ | basic ios
 
 
 
 
char_type widen( char c ) const;

将字符 c 转换为其在当前区域设置中的等效字符。结果将从 char 转换为流中使用的字符类型(如果需要)。

实际上调用 std::use_facet< std::ctype<char_type> >(getloc()).widen(c).

[编辑] 参数

c - 要转换的字符

[编辑] 返回值

转换为 char_type 的字符

[编辑] 另请参见

缩小字符
(公有成员函数) [编辑]
[虚拟]
将一个或多个字符从 char 转换为 CharT
(std::ctype<CharT> 的虚拟受保护成员函数) [编辑]
如果可能,将单字节窄字符扩展为宽字符
(函数) [编辑]